Quiet Riot's first metal/hard rock album after the their AOR/arena rock years, sometimes seen as a sort of "second debut" as the first two albums were originally only released in Japan.

Considered one of the first albums to break heavy metal into the general mainstream with the #1 hit "Cum on Feel the Noize".

"Slick Black Cadillac" is a re-recorded song from Quiet Riot II.

The song "Metal Health" is the opening song of the 2008 film The Wrestler.

This album is dedicated to the memory of Randy Rhoads.

Besides the regular black vinyl it was also released as a picture disc.

Recording information:

Recorded and mixed at Pasha Music House.
